Easy Baked Italian Meatballs: An Incredible Ultimate Recipe

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 pound ground pork
  • 1 cup breadcrumbs
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h basil
  • 2 large eggs
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ional)
  • 1 cup marinara sauce (for serving)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ine ground beef, ground pork, bre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, parsley, basil, eggs, garlic, salt, black pepper, oregano, thyme, and red pepper flakes (if using).
  3. Using your hands, mix the ingredients until just combined. Be careful not to overmix. Form the mixture into meatballs, about 1 to 1.5 inches in size.
  4. Arrange the meatballs on the prepared baking sheet, ensuring they are spaced evenly apart.
  5.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es or until the meatballs are browned and cooked through.
  6. To ensure they are fully cooked, the internal temperature should reach 160°F (70°C).
  7. Once cooked, remove the meatballs from the oven and let them rest for a few minutes before serving with marinara sauce.
